Why Dads Want Different Gifts in 2026

According to the National Retail Federation, Father's Day spending reached a record $24 billion in 2025, with the average shopper spending nearly $200 on gifts. The stat that stands out: 46% of shoppers said it's most important to find a gift that's unique or different, and 37% wanted something that creates a special memory.

2. An Experience Day

Experience gifts are the fastest-growing Father's Day category — 30% of shoppers planned to give one in 2025, up from 23% in 2019. A cooking class, whiskey tasting, driving experience, or a day at a local sporting event. The memories outlast any gadget he'll stop using in six months.
